Platform vs Protocol
| Layer | What it is | Lives at |
|---|---|---|
| h.computer | The hosted platform — auth, hosting, the on-site H agent, themes, cron, embeds, the gallery, billing. Lovable for personal sites. | {you}.computer |
| hstack | The portable contract every instance ships — REST endpoints, MCP server, owner-scoped hk_ keys, an AGENTS.md, and a baseline skill bundle. Open spec. | /api/v1, /api/public/mcp |
| you.md | Your context layer — bio, projects, agent directives, custom files. Your computer pulls it on a TTL and recompiles its identity. | you.md/{you} |

What you actually get
you.md is the source of truth
Your computer doesn't store your identity — it syncs it. Edit your you.md, your computer updates within a few hours, no redeploy. Bio, project list, agent directives, and custom files all flow through. Swap context layers and your computer becomes a different person.
Skills & tools
A skill is a markdown file that teaches a visiting agent how to do something on your computer (append to journal, publish a post, refresh a connector). A tool is an MCP endpoint that actually does it. Together they're the installable surface of your computer — see Build Your Own to author your first one.
Connectors
Connectors are the bridges between your computer and the rest of your stack. See the full live grid at /connections — h.computer ships first-party connectors for Gmail, Google Calendar, GitHub, Slack, Notion, Stripe, Firecrawl, you.md, folder.md, bamf.ai, marine/meteor weather + surf, hubify, and more. Any agent with a valid hk_ key can call through them.
